The Big Picture: Trends Driving Local Government in 2026

Local governments are navigating complex dynamics that reflect broader societal shifts. Across regions, common themes include financial sustainability, modernization of services, and strengthening democratic structures.

1. Financial Realities and Budget Priorities

Balancing budgets continues to be a defining challenge:

  • Many councils are facing funding shortfalls, with some authorities raising local taxes to sustain essential services such as social care and infrastructure maintenance. Analysis in the UK highlights a trend where council tax is likely to grow significantly as local authorities cope with rising costs and limited central government grant support.
  • In India, municipal leaders are revising civic budgets ahead of elections to expand services like senior transit programs and local markets, demonstrating how fiscal planning directly affects community amenities.

These examples underline that fiscal innovation and transparency will be central to local government credibility and effectiveness in 2026.

Governance Reforms and Structural Changes

Across multiple countries, local authorities are revisiting how they are organized and how they operate.

2. Redrawing Boundaries and Authority Arrangements

Governance structures are shifting to improve coordination and accountability:

  • In the UK, plans to reorganize councils are delaying elections in some areas as authorities transition to streamlined arrangements. This reflects broader efforts to simplify governance layers and reduce administrative complexity.
  • New combined authorities, such as proposals in Essex and Hampshire, aim to consolidate regional powers under elected leaders to enhance strategic decision-making on housing, transportation, and economic development.

These reforms are designed to better align local priorities with regional planning, though they require careful public engagement to maintain democratic legitimacy.

Service Delivery and Citizen Experience

Local governments are increasingly embracing innovation to improve how services are delivered.

3. Digital Transformation and Technology Adoption

Modern governance in 2026 is not just administrative—it’s digital:

  • Many local governments are integrating AI, cloud computing, and advanced cybersecurity practices to enhance digital service quality, public access, and responsiveness. Government IT trends for 2026 highlight this shift from pilot projects toward mature operational systems.

These technologies make it easier for residents to access information online, streamline bureaucratic processes, and fortify public data security—all while freeing human resources to focus on higher-value tasks.

Deepening Democracy and Civic Engagement

A core mission of local government is ensuring that governance remains participatory and representative.

4. Elections, Representation & Local Decision-Making

Local elections remain essential to democratic legitimacy:

  • Across England, multiple councils are preparing for scheduled 2026 polls, reflecting ongoing commitment to democratic renewal despite institutional changes underway.

Ensuring accessible and fair elections at the local level helps maintain public trust and civic engagement, especially during periods of structural reform.

Case Studies: Practical Shifts in 2026

Real-world examples illustrate these trends in action:

Community Ownership of Local Projects

The UK’s new Local Power Plan exemplifies decentralization in action. With a multibillion-pound investment in locally owned renewable energy projects, communities will gain control over clean power generation and reinvest profits locally—strengthening economic resilience and sustainability.

Urban Planning and Land Use Reform

Some city administrations are revising land-use regulations to reduce red tape and encourage flexible development, enabling mixed-use spaces and streamlined urban growth strategies.

These examples showcase how local initiatives can directly drive economic opportunity, environmental stewardship, and quality of life improvements.

Expert Perspectives: What This Means for 2026 and Beyond

Industry analysts identify several overarching trends:

  • Local governments are under pressure to clarify roles, strengthen cooperation across departments, and modernize workforce capabilities in the face of evolving governance challenges.
  • Digital transformation and adoption of emerging technologies remain key for smarter service delivery and long-term resilience.

These strategic imperatives reflect an ongoing transition toward more flexible, transparent, and community-oriented governance models.

Conclusion: A Year of Strategic Change

Local government in 2026 is shaped by competing demands for fiscal sustainability, technological modernization, and democratic accountability. Across continents, municipalities are leaning into reforms designed to empower citizens, make services more responsive, and build governance systems that are adaptive and transparent. Success will depend on thoughtful policy design, inclusive public engagement, and sustained investment in human and technological capital.
